The October Birthstones: Opal and Tourmaline
The October birthstones—opal and tourmaline—each possess unique properties that contribute to their spiritual and practical value. Opal, the traditional October birthstone, is celebrated for its mesmerizing play-of-color, a phenomenon that occurs due to the diffraction of light within its structure. This dynamic display of color symbolizes hope, creativity, and emotional balance. Opal is often associated with the qualities of intuition and self-expression, making it an ideal stone for individuals seeking to enhance their personal and creative energies.
Tourmaline, the modern October birthstone, is renowned for its diverse color palette and protective qualities. Pink tourmaline, in particular, is cherished for its gentle energy, which is believed to promote emotional healing and foster compassion. The versatility of tourmaline makes it an excellent complement to opal, offering a broader range of symbolic meanings and energetic benefits.

Caring for October Birthstones
Proper care is essential for maintaining the beauty and effectiveness of opal and tourmaline. These gemstones require special attention to ensure that their energies remain strong and their physical properties are preserved.
Cleaning and Maintenance
Opal should be cleaned gently with a soft cloth and lukewarm water. Harsh chemicals or ultrasonic cleaners should be avoided, as they can damage the delicate structure of the gemstone. Tourmaline can be cleaned with mild soap and warm water, but it should also be handled with care to avoid scratches or other damage.
Both gemstones should be stored separately from other jewelry to prevent scratching. A soft pouch or a dedicated jewelry box can help protect their surfaces and maintain their luster.
